Advantages of Using Wireless Access Points As they move through the building, their devices shift seamlessly from one access point to the next without dropping the connection-they won’t even realize they’re switching between networks. By installing access points throughout the office, users can roam freely from room to room without experiencing network interruptions. Depending on the number of devices you have connected simultaneously, a range extender could end up weighing down your connection.Īccess points, on the other hand, can handle over 60 simultaneous connections each. While range extenders do increase the coverage of a Wi-Fi router, they do not increase its available bandwidth. This is because they can only support a limited number of devices at one time, usually no more than 20. While range extenders are great for home Wi-Fi networks, they’re not efficient for modern businesses. Why Access Points Are Better for Businesses For instance, if your router is in the basement of a two-story building, installing a range extenderon the ground floor (where coverage from the Wi-Fi router is still strong) will eliminate potential dead zones on the second floor. Since range extenders connect wirelessly to Wi-Fi routers, they must be placed where the Wi-Fi router's signal is already strong, not in the location of the actual dead spot. What is a Range Extender?Īs its name implies, a range extender lengthens the reach of an existing Wi-Fi network. For example, if you want to enable Wi-Fi access in your company's reception area but don’t have a router within range, you can install an access point near the front desk and run an Ethernet cable through the ceiling back to the server room. An access point connects to a wired router, switch, or hub via an Ethernet cable, and projects a Wi-Fi signal to a designated area.

What is an Access Point?Īn access point is a device that creates a wireless local area network, or WLAN, usually in an office or large building. Let’s take a look at how their features compare to find the best Wi-Fi solution for you. Large office spaces with heavy traffic typically utilize Wi-Fi access points, while small offices with limited users are more likely to have Wi-Fi routers and range extenders. Wi-Fi technology has improved greatly in recent years, but it’s not one-size-fits-all, especially when it comes to businesses.
